Output 24ecb6ce25d7da71b0535e2414ca7a8f2c53e1c0836bf61af5bc98f6bad4579a:504

value
17681
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b16345e93ce05fb442fa6692917368fa8bc0bd6bf3a456041a1a5d9c2cfb4415
address
bc1pk935t6fuup0mgsh6v6ffzumgl29up0tt7wj9vpq6rfwect8mgs2su5xefm
transaction
24ecb6ce25d7da71b0535e2414ca7a8f2c53e1c0836bf61af5bc98f6bad4579a
confirmations
106726
spent
true